Hello,
We are currently using v9.2.4.
Using project and planned date, I come accross a strange behavior (maybe a bug ?) on all of our project.
I have a created a very simple project for the purpose of the explanation (see screenshots : project 75, activity 319 and activity 320):
- The project 75 has 2 activities, linked with a dependancy (319 « lancement » is predecessor of 320 « réalisation »)
- The project starts the 04/10/2021      
- The two activities has an assignement (resource Test chef de projet), for 5 days each
                o   The resource is not staffed on any other project on october     
-  Activities are on « as soon as possible » planning mode 

My understanding, after reading the user manual, is that planned date are calculated using the assignement, dependencies and planning mode. In my case, I am expecting an activity 319 ending on 08/10 and the activity 320 to start on 11/10 and finish on 15/10.
After clicking on the calculate capacity planning button (the calculator) using the date of 04/10, I have the following (see screenshot planning gantt) :
 -  Activity 319 starts on 04/10 but has one day of duration
- Activity 320 starts on 30/09/2021

Am I missing something regarding planned date ? Is it a bug ? I can provide more information and screenshots if needed.
Thanks for your help ! 
Best regards

Hi,
Yes, this seems weird.
Please check capacity of your resource : check that it is not null.
If issue is not there, please show sceenshots of Gant bar detail (right click on each bar)
Thanks

Hi,
you are right ! Capacity was 0 for this resource.

I'm a bit confused because these resources were created from an import and I was assuming that everything was right... I will check it for every resource now.

It could be a great improvement to make the field mandatory in a future version, in order to make users look at this field.

Everything works fine now. Thank you for your help

Setting capacity to required may not be a good idea as it may fit some use cases to have zero capacity (avoid planning one resource, testing, ...)
But it may be a good idea to marks such cases in the planning (as some not planned activities, appering in purple)
